Transaction 759d59f571af1b0929efff377ad8fecc216bc4128f885a7c850221aeb436086a
1 Input
2 Outputs
- 759d59f571af1b0929efff377ad8fecc216bc4128f885a7c850221aeb436086a:0
- 759d59f571af1b0929efff377ad8fecc216bc4128f885a7c850221aeb436086a:1
value 92459896
address 1MrMr8Xew3mu1GU198W32kYykqcmkgtRwg
value 1996627127
address 19zMK6WEZ3Si157AhoLEng4funoXxyYHAU